Key Responsibilities

* Prepare and review monthly, quarterly, and annual financial statements in compliance with relevant accounting standards (e.g., IFRS).
* Manage and reconcile general ledger accounts, ensuring accuracy and completeness of financial data.
* Process accounts payable and accounts receivable, including invoice verification, payment processing, and timely collections.
* Assist in the development and implementation of internal controls to safeguard company assets and ensure financial accuracy.
* Conduct variance analysis and provide insights into financial performance, identifying trends and recommending corrective actions.
* Support the budgeting and forecasting processes, contributing to the development of realistic financial plans.
* Collaborate with external auditors during financial audits, providing necessary documentation and explanations.
* Maintain accurate and organized financial records and documentation in accordance with company policies and regulatory requirements.

Requirements

* Bachelor’s degree in Accounting, Finance, or a related field.
* Professional accounting qualification (e.g., ACCA, ICAN) is highly desirable.
* Minimum of 3-5 years of progressive accounting experience, preferably within the Oil & Gas industry.
* Proficiency in accounting software (e.g., SAP, Oracle) and Microsoft Excel.
* Strong understanding of Nigerian financial regulations and tax laws.
* Excellent analytical, problem-solving, and critical-thinking skills.
* Ability to work independently and as part of a team, with strong attention to detail and organizational abilities.
